Under the general supervision of the Emergency Medical Services (EMS) Supervisor or higher-level officer, an employee in this class takes charge of all Emergency Medical Technicians (EMTs) and ancillary personnel on their assigned shift. This is specialized work in the protection of life and property through the performance of emergency medical services for the Virgin Islands Fire and Emergency Medical Service (VIFEMS). An Advanced Emergency Medical Technician (AEMT) manages staff engaged in EMS duties and manages the station on a day-to-day basis. The position involves responding to all emergency medical requests and rendering advanced emergency medical (AEMT) assistance to all patients as required. It also includes performing initial and management of illness or injury to patients in accordance with specified protocol and procedure, preparing patients for transport, and providing direct advanced (AEMT) level and comprehensive patient care. The role also entails leading, guiding, and/or assisting in the training of lower-level technicians and/or students, following established departmental policies, and checking emergency medical equipment for serviceability. Completing and transferring patient care information and records is also a key duty.
